Centre d'art contemporain La Halle des bouchers
About This Museum
People come to La Halle des Bouchers not just to see art, but to experience it. Housed in a dramatically repurposed medieval butcher's hall, this contemporary art center feels both ancient and thrillingly modern. The curators have a knack for selecting challenging, often large-scale installations that command the raw, cavernous space. You'll leave feeling like you've had a genuine encounter with the pulse of today's art scene, far from the hushed tones of a traditional museum.
Collection Highlights
Don't expect a permanent collection; the magic here is in the ever-changing roster of temporary exhibitions. They often feature immersive video works, bold sculptural pieces that play with the building's history, and provocative international artists you might not discover elsewhere.

Architecture & Building
The building itself is the star: a stunning example of adaptive reuse where rough-hewn stone walls, massive wooden beams, and the ghosts of its past life as a meat market create an unforgettable backdrop for cutting-edge art.
